Fiberglass Mesh for Plastering An Essential Component for Durable Construction


In the realm of construction and renovation, ensuring the durability and strength of walls is paramount. One innovative solution that has gained traction in recent years is the use of fiberglass mesh for plastering. This versatile and durable material has become a staple for both professional builders and DIY enthusiasts alike, thanks to its myriad benefits and applications.


Fiberglass mesh is a woven fabric made from strands of glass fiber, which are known for their strength and resistance to various stresses. Unlike traditional materials such as metal lath or paper, fiberglass mesh does not corrode over time, making it a superior choice for exterior and interior plaster applications. Its non-corrosive nature ensures that it maintains its structural integrity, thus contributing to the longevity of plasterwork.


When plastering walls, one of the major challenges is managing the stress that occurs due to temperature fluctuations and moisture changes. Traditional plaster can crack over time under these conditions. However, incorporating fiberglass mesh into the plastering process provides added reinforcement, effectively distributing stress across the surface. This reduces the likelihood of cracks developing, resulting in a smoother and more uniform finish.


Moreover, fiberglass mesh enhances adhesion of the plaster to surfaces. When mesh is embedded within the plaster, it creates a mechanical bond that significantly improves the overall stability of the plaster layer. This is particularly beneficial for surfaces that are prone to movement, such as those subjected to vibrations or those in seismic regions. By providing a reliable anchor, fiberglass mesh helps maintain the integrity of plastered walls, mitigating potential failures.

In addition to its strength and durability, fiberglass mesh is also lightweight and easy to handle. It can be easily cut to size, making it suitable for a variety of plastering applications, whether it’s a large wall or intricate detailing work. This ease of use not only speeds up the plastering process but also minimizes the physical strain on workers, making it a favored choice amongst contractors.


Another significant advantage of fiberglass mesh is its versatility. It is compatible with various types of plaster, including traditional cement-based plasters and modern synthetic options. This adaptability allows for a broad range of applications, from residential to commercial buildings. Additionally, fiberglass mesh can be used in various environments, whether indoors or outdoors, making it suitable for numerous construction projects.


Sustainability is increasingly becoming a crucial factor in construction, and fiberglass mesh offers an eco-friendly option. Its longevity reduces the need for frequent repairs or replacements, leading to lower overall material consumption and waste. Furthermore, many fiberglass mesh products are manufactured using environmentally responsible processes, aligning with the industry's growing emphasis on sustainability.


Finally, safety is an essential consideration in any construction project. Fiberglass mesh is non-combustible, meaning it will not contribute to the spread of flames in the event of a fire. This characteristic adds an extra layer of safety to structures, making them more resilient during emergencies.
